The TomTom iOS app version 1.27 was released on 30th March 2017 with the following message:

"Rapid changes in TomTom and Apple Technologies mean that we cannot continue offering updates to this app indefinitely. For this reason we will not be supporting this app from September (2017) onwards".

The replacement app (TomTom GO Mobile for iOS) is currently about as useful as a chocolate teapot despite having been released for over a year with about four updates in that time. So TomTom GO Mobile for iOS is not an option for me.

So, what are you going to use as a SatNav? Will you still use your iPhone for SatNav, if so what app will you use?
Will you change to a PND, if so which?
Will you change to an Android phone and if so which app will you use?

I have a few SatNav apps on my iPhone, whilst the old TomTom app is my favourite I will be forced by TomTom to stop using it after September (if I want to continue using Traffic). The iOS version of GO Mobile is still useless, so that app is not an option. The other SatNav apps are useable but the ones I've tried recently don't give the same amount of information about the journey (on screen all of the time) that I'm used to with the old TomTom iOS app.

The things I want in a SatNav app are:
1. Full journey info (see later for list)
2. Accurate traffic and ability to reroute due to traffic.
3. Custom (third party) POIs

Full journey info (to be kept on screen all the time):

Current speed
Speed limit
Total distance remaining
Next action (turning)
Distance to next action
Total journey time remaining
ETA
Current road
Next road
Lane Guidance

So, what are users of the old TomTom iOS app going to use?

Your problem is going to be support for 3rd party POIs. I went through this but I wanted to move from a 5" Garmin screen to a 7" plus screen. In the end I went down the Android tablet route.

I loaded all the decent navigation apps and tried them out. My main requirement was for traffic and 3rd party POI support (not just speed cameras). Traffic was easy, POI support wasn't.

iGo has dropped support for them. Navigon doesn't support them. Others did (possibly Sygic and CoPilot) but one of those was broken. Aponia supported third party POIs but in the end I settled on Mapfactor which does most of what you want.

You can upgrade the map to TomTom maps if you want. It supports 3rd party POIs (though a bit of a faff initially), it has traffic, it supports camera warnings and is very customisable, e.g. routing preferences for each type of road can be weighted. I use that with CameraAlert running in the background.

I am keeping my Garmin as a backup as it has always done a good job and supports third party POIs. I would also say that their traffic system is as good as TomTom's now.

I hope this helps.

Menu | Change Settings | About

v1.27.1 map number (for UK & Ireland) is v985.8209
v1.27.1 map number (for Europe) is v985.8177

v1.28 map number (for UK & Ireland) is v990.8363
v1.28.1 map number (for Europe) is v990.8324

Nb.:
1. I have only installed v1.28 (UK&I and Europe) onto my iPhone 5 and not yet the 6 so test not fully complete.
2. On iPhone 5, Europe is v1.28.1 while UK&I is only v1.28. So there's a slight version discrepancy between map areas.

By the way, if anybody who has upgraded to TomTom iOS legacy app 1.28(.1) and didn't read the blurb, then here's the full information:

From the App Store:

27 Jul 2017
In March we informed you that this app will not be supported starting September onward. Check the app to find out more about what this means for you, and how to keep using the app for as long as possible.
LATEST, UPDATED TOMTOM MAP: Because roads are constantly changing – on average 15% of roads change every year – your TomTom App update comes with the latest and most up-to-date map.

Taken from the iPhone app (UK & Ireland v1.28) when started for first time:

In March we informed you that this app cannot be supported from September onwards. Select the button below to find out more about what this means for you, and how to keep using the app for as long as possible

Why are updates stopping?

This app is based on an old version of TomTom’s core navigation technology that is no longer being actively developed or maintained. This technology is built into an app that developed originally for iOS3 and then overhauled in iOS7. As TomTom and Apple technology evolves, it becomes increasing difficult and expensive to retain support for older products such as this one. TomTom has decided to focus its efforts on delivering products based on our latest (and best) navigation and mapping technologies and sadly this means that we cannot continue to deliver updates to this app.

When is the last update?

The last release of this app will be in September and will include a map update.

What happens after this?

The last update of this app will be tested on the latest available version of iOS. Future versions of iOS may introduce changes that lead to problems with the performance and features of this application. At some point one or more of these changes will cause the application to stop running on the latest version of iOS.

How can I keep using this app?

We can assure you that this app will continue to work when running on the latest iOS version available t the time of it’s release. If you upgrade to future iOS versions we cannot guarantee that the app will continue to run.

So is this the end of TomTom on my iPhone?

No, we will continue to deliver world-class navigation for iPhone in the TomTom GO Mobile app. As an existing customer you are entitled to a free 3 year subscription, so you can continue using our navigation for years to come.

Why should I use TomTom GO Mobile instead?

We’ve been working hard to improve the TomTom GO Mobile app with every release. We’ve added many new features and improvements including alternative routes and stops on route, with more features on the way.

What happens to my months of traffic/speed cams that I bought when this app is no longer supported?

As the app is no longer supported, we cannot guarantee you will be able to access your purchases.
